      J'ai postulé en ligne. Le processus a pris 1 semaine. J'ai passé un entretien chez Zenefits en déc. 2014

      Entretien

      Applied for one position online and was sent an email saying that my profile was better fit for this position. I received a request to schedule a time to speak with someone over the phone about my skills and the position available, which I did, when my day/time came she never called me I had to send her an email stating that I was waiting and unsure if we needed to reschedule our appt or what. An hour later the recruiter calls me stating her previous call went over (I wish she would have sent a email notifying me of that prior, but whatever). WE spoke for 45mins or so about the position my skills and if I would be a good fit for the role. Prior to disconnecting she wanted to schedule me for a in-person interview but wasn't sure of the schedule so someone called me following day with a day/time to come in person. I received a confirmation email of my appt and the Sunday prior I received a call confirming. The interview was setup in a speed dating style (as they described it) I sat at one table and completed 2 email request from angry clients (had 30mins to complete, someone sat with me to answer any questions I had during the process). From there I was moved to speak with the Director inn which we spoke about my skills and abilities etc for 30mins.... from there I was placed with a Manager over the dept where we discussed the role in a bit more detail and I was able to ask any questions that arose during the conversation. Everyone was nice although everything felt a bit rushed, you can tell they are in a rush to hire, hire, hire. After leaving I had my mind made up that if they call me back with an offer I would decline, it seems as if they are moving so swift that there's not much organization within the process. I waited a week or so when I didn't hear anything back from them in which they told me I had not been selected (whew). In closing I feel like with all the calling and emailing throughout the process an immediate "thanks, but no thanks" email would have been nice. But oh well.       J'ai postulé en ligne. Le processus a pris 4 jours. J'ai passé un entretien chez Zenefits (Tempe, AZ)

      Entretien

      It involved a phone interview, followed by a 2 and a half on site interview with 3 people in person and one via Skype. After my time there I reached out and thanked the recruiters for their time. On the phone the job sounded amazing, but what they seemed to want was employees who don't really have a family or outside life, outside of the job and the 12-14 hours that you would be required to work, daily. I but I found the process rather long and time consuming. And the canned response email I received as for the reason for not being offered the position was rather confusing, I was praised for my experience and skills but was told I wasn't the "right fit" at this time. No elaboration was provided. I decided not to pursue, because ultimately I knew I could do better and found a better position elsewhere that allowed for more of a balance between work and my personal life.
